Php fpm nginx unix socket programming

    images php fpm nginx unix socket programming

    Although these parameters are not necessary, they simplify the deployment of virtual hosts. Note: For your system to function properly, you must create a new pool for every virtual host that you set up. This allows for some greater security and usability in many cases, but it can also complicate things when you need to allow an external program e. If enabled, passwords which don't match the specified criteria will be rejected by MySQL with an error. Your LEMP stack should now be completely set up. Type the address that you receive in your web browser and it will take you to Nginx's default landing page:.

  • How To Install Linux, Nginx, MySQL, PHP (LEMP stack) on Ubuntu DigitalOcean
  • inanzzz Using unix socket for phpfpm and nginx docker setup
  • PHPFPM and Nginx don't work using unix sockets Server Fault
  • PHPFPM with Unix Sockets + Nginx in Docker · GitHub

  • This article explains how to install NGINX and PHP-FPM while running on UNIX file sockets for your Debian-based system.

    How To Install Linux, Nginx, MySQL, PHP (LEMP stack) on Ubuntu DigitalOcean

    Set up the server. Here is how you can switch PHP-FPM to listen on a unix socket For this example I'm also going to show how to make the switch in Nginx. Proxy PHP requests with NGINX and FastCGI using PHP-FPM. on Ubuntu as an example, and the /etc/php//fpm/pool.d/ and.

    images php fpm nginx unix socket programming

    reasons for PHP-FPM to listen on a UNIX socket instead of a TCP address.
    Introduction The LEMP software stack is a group of software that can be used to serve dynamic web pages and web applications. Home Questions Tags Users Unanswered.

    inanzzz Using unix socket for phpfpm and nginx docker setup

    With both pools configured to use the same socket, there is certainly a conflict here. The file contains two include parameters in the Virtual Host Configs area, which allow you to have a separate configuration file directory and a separate virtual host file directory. However, you still don't have anything that can generate dynamic content. Sign into your account, or create a new one, to start interacting.

    PHPFPM and Nginx don't work using unix sockets Server Fault

    Language: EN.

    images php fpm nginx unix socket programming
    DOPPIETTA AVANCARICA PREZZO RESTAURANT
    Almost there! However, we still don't have anything that can generate dynamic content.

    Before you complete this tutorial, you should have a regular, non-root user account on your server with sudo privileges.

    PHPFPM with Unix Sockets + Nginx in Docker · GitHub

    Next, check which authentication method each of your MySQL user accounts use with the following command:. Not using Ubuntu In this example, the new server block configuration file is named example.

    :/etc/nginx/conf.d/ - /private/var/log/nginx:/var/log/nginx - " phpsocket:/var/run" networks: code-network php: image: php:fpm. Files: /etc/nginx/sites-available/default # stuff omitted server PHP-FPM's unix socket therefore needs to be readable/writable by this user.

    images php fpm nginx unix socket programming

    Setting up nginx and PHP-FPM in Docker with Unix Sockets This prevents any nefarious PHP code from doing something it shouldn't, at the.
    Either give more permissions to you socket file, or change a listening user, or change nginx user Not using Ubuntu Twitter Facebook Hacker News.

    This is an acronym that describes a Linux operating system, with an Nginx web server. By Justin Ellingwood.

    Video: Php fpm nginx unix socket programming How to install Nginx, PHP7, Mysql in Ubuntu 16.04

    images php fpm nginx unix socket programming
    TRAPPABLE PETS ORDER AND CHAOS WIKI
    Following is an example of how you can change your nginx.

    Twitter Facebook Hacker News. For example, you should ensure that connections to your server are secured.

    Video: Php fpm nginx unix socket programming Getting Started - PHP, FPM, and Nginx Config

    Not using Ubuntu We will tell Nginx to pass PHP requests to this software for processing. If you want to use NGINX in your deployment of a virtual host, you can also add the following files:. Your LEMP stack should now be completely set up.

    5 Replies to “Php fpm nginx unix socket programming”

    1. We hope you find this tutorial helpful. Now, we have all of the required components installed.

    2. We now have our PHP components installed, but we need to make a slight configuration change to make our setup more secure. It is safe to leave validation disabled, but you should always use strong, unique passwords for database credentials.